Merchant Banking Devision

Goldman Sachs Group, Merchant Banking Division is the private equity and venture capital firm of Goldman Sachs Group Inc. specializing in corporate and real estate investments worldwide. The firm typically invests through Principal Investment Area (PIA), the Real Estate Principal Investment Area, Infrastructure Investment Group, and the Real Estate Alternatives. The Principal Investment Area includes GS Capital Partners and GS Mezzanine Partners funds managing the private corporate equity and mezzanine investment activities, respectively on a global basis and GS Technology Partners. The GS Capital Partners fund focuses on investments in take privates or leveraged buyouts or management buyouts, expansion or growth investments in private or public companies, acquisitions, build-ups, recapitalizations, private closely held companies, restructurings and special situations, and GS direct. In GS direct, the fund invests across a broad range of industries in different forms of private equity or mezzanine investments.
